Thorsten Pech (born 3 November 1960) is a German church musician.
Born in Wuppertal, Pech studied Protestant church music[1] at the Robert Schumann Hochschule Düsseldorf from 1976 to 1980 with Hanns-Alfons Siegel (organ), Alberte Brun (piano), Hartmut Schmidt (choir direction).
[2] After his postgraduate studies in organ and participation in various master classes (among others Daniel Roth, Anton Heiller) he passed his final examination in 1983 with Hans-Dieter Möller.
[2] Pech completed his conducting studies in Vienna with Julius Kalmar in 1985 with a diploma.
[3] In 1998 he was awarded the title music director by the Fachverband der Chorleiter [de].
